Design Details

Minimalist Scandinavian loft cottage designed specifically for extremely low energy use. This compact 288 square feet tiny house features a cathedral ceiling to inspire creative work, a full working kitchen, ventless laundry, three point bath and queen sized sleeping loft. Ideal as a backyard accessory dwelling unit, rural cabin, cottage, mother-in-law home, office or Airbnb rental.

  • 288 square feet

  • 1 queen sized sleeping loft, ladder access, window egress

  • 1 bath

  • 1 level + loft

  • Ceiling height (below loft): 8’-8” with open beams/joists or 7’-8 ¼” with ceiling

  • Ceiling height (living room/cathedral): 16’-0”

  • Loft ceiling height: 6’-0” at peak

  • Design standard: International Residential Code - Appendix Q for Tiny Houses

  • Estimated cost to build is $100-155 per square foot depending on zip code.

  • Size: 12’ x 24’

  • Height: 17’-4 ⅞”

  • Walls: 2x6, R-40

  • Roof: 2X12, R-60, standing seam metal or composite shingles, 12:12

  • Foundation: Super-insulated slab

  • Heating/cooling: Heat pump (mini-split)

  • Fireplace/wood-stove: optional

  • Water heating: Tankless electric

  • Ventilation: HRV/ERV (What’s this?)
